Gazing up at the sky, the moment the sun hid behind the moon, something shifted within us—a connection that went beyond a scientifc phenomenon into a moment of prayer. Deacon Mike, Father Damian and Father Eric Garris unpack this celestial spectacle they shared together in Cleveland, and its profound effect on each of them. Aligning with the Feast of the Annunciation, our hearts and minds were opened as we learned the subtle yet powerful distinction between being in totality and being only 98%. The teachings of St. Ignatius of Loyola guide our conversation, illuminating the call to embrace and share the Gospel, stirred by our shared observance of the eclipse. We talk about pictures and we talk about the value of keeping and returning to pictures on our phone. What's the first picture on your phone?
